What is an AI agent

AI agent (AI agent) refers to a computer program designed and programmed using AI technology, which can independently perform certain tasks and respond to the environment. An AI agent can be viewed as an agent that perceives its environment, changes it through its own decisions and actions, and improves its performance by learning and adapting. Using both short-term memory (contextual learning) and long-term memory (retrieval of information from external vector stores), the agent has the ability to plan by "thinking" step by step, break down goals into smaller tasks, and reflect on its own performance.

AI agents usually incorporate multiple technologies, such as machine learning, natural language processing, computer vision, planning, and reasoning, that enable agents to process information and make decisions autonomously.

What is an autonomous agent supported by LLM

Lilian Weng, director of AI application research at OpenAI, recently published a 10,000-word long article on AI agents: "Autonomous Agents Supported by Large Language Models (LLM)", which provides an in-depth interpretation of what is an AI agent application built by LLM training. There are many excellent applications of AI agents supported by LLM, such as AutoGPT, GPT-Engineer, BabyAGI, and SuperAGI.

In an LLM-powered autonomous agent system, the LLM acts as the brain of the agent and is complemented by several key components: Planning, Memory, and Tool Use.

This agent breaks down large tasks into smaller, manageable sub-goals, enabling efficient handling of complex tasks. It also allows for self-criticism and self-reflection about past actions, learning from mistakes and refining for future steps, thereby improving the quality of the end result.

A special feature of the LLM autonomous agent is that it is like having a "memory", which is capable of short-term (long-term) remembering what it has learned during training. In addition, LLM autonomously brings the ability to learn to call external APIs to obtain additional information missing in model weights (usually difficult to change after pre-training), including current information, code execution capabilities, access to proprietary information sources, etc.

As mentioned by Lilian Weng, there are also some common limitations of LLM autonomous agents, including limited context length, challenges of long-term planning and task decomposition, stability of LLM, etc.
